Skip to Sidebar Skip to Content

Slew of Letter Bombs Target Pro-Ukrainian Institutions in Spain

Slew of Letter Bombs Target Pro-Ukrainian Institutions in Spain

Subscribe to Atlas

Receive weekly strategic insights and actionable intelligence empowering professionals and decision-makers around the world.